Bradenton, FL (August 13, 2020) - A man was killed in a motor scooter crash that took place in Bradenton on Thursday, August 13th. The crash happened in the eastbound lanes of State Road 64.
Police and rescue crews arrived at the scene around 1:30 p.m. According to reports, the moped driver attempted to cross a street near 52nd Street East. The moped was hit by a vehicle that was traveling westbound. The moped driver was killed in the crash. His identity has not been released at this time. No other injuries were reported.
State Road 64 was closed briefly while police investigated the crash. The road was down to one lane until it reopened at about 3:30 p.m. Police are still investigating the crash at this time and no further information has been released.
